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/phpmyadmin/phpmyadmin.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2022-11-12Extract schema export from schema pluginsMaurício Meneghini Fauth
Moves the response handling to the SchemaExportController.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-12Replace escapeString with quoteString in ImportControllerM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-12Merge branch 'QA_5_2'William Desportes
Signed-off-by: William Desportes <williamdes@wdes.fr>
2022-11-11Refactor Export::processExportSchema() to use DatabaseName objectM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-11Fix TypeError in Server\ReplicationController classMaurício Meneghini Fauth
Fixes https://github.com/phpmyadmin/phpmyadmin/issues/17875 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-10Refactor Tracking export download to remove `exit`Maur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-10Refactor SavedSearches class to use ExceptionsM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-09Improve error message when UseDbSearch config is disabledMaurício Meneghini Fauth
Replaces Html\Generator::mysqlDie() to avoid calling the exit construct.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-09Replace escapeString in Table::getColumnGenerationExpressionM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-09Fix broken single column change page introduced by #17862Tobias Speicher
Signed-off-by: Tobias Speicher <rootcommander@gmail.com>
2022-11-09Replace $_POST with ServerRequest object in Table\OperationsControllerM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-09Merge pull request #17882 from kamil-tekiela/Refactor-index-controllersMaurício Meneghini Fauth
Refactor index controllers
2022-11-09Merge pull request #17881 from kamil-tekiela/Refactor-PrimaryController.phpMaurício Meneghini Fauth
Redesign PrimaryController
2022-11-08Refactor BinlogController.phpK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-08Replace $_REQUEST with ServerRequest in Util::getDbInfo()Maur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-08Remove the sub_part global variableMaurício Meneghini Fauth
It's only used inside Util::getDbInfo() for pagination when not exporting.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-08Minor fixes in getSqlQueryForIndexCreateOrEdit()Kam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-08Fix wrong type for keyBlockSizesK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-08Redesign PrimaryControllerK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-08Merge pull request #17879 from MauricioFauth/tracking-datetimeMaurício Meneghini Fauth
Refactor `$dateFrom` and `$dateTo` to use `DateTimeImmutable`
2022-11-08Refactor isEngine() methodK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-07Refactor $dateFrom and $dateTo to use DateTimeImmutableMaurício Meneghini Fauth
Uses the DateTimeImmutable object to validate the datetime values of the $dateFrom and $dateTo variables in the Tracking class.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-07Remove filter_ts_* global variablesMaurício Meneghini Fauth
Replaces them with $dateFrom and $dateTo variables.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-06Merge pull request #17872 from kamil-tekiela/Remove-$params-2Maurício Meneghini Fauth
Refactoring of Processes.php
2022-11-06Implement quoteString()Kam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-06Remove $_POST variables from Table\TrackingControllerM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-06Remove unnecessary global variable 'data'Maurício Meneghini Fauth
Replaces it with a regular varible.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-06Improve type inference of Tracker::getTrackedData()Maur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-06Remove usage of $_POST['logtype']Maurício Meneghini Fauth
- Replaces with variable get from ServerRequest object - Renames it log_type for readability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-06Remove $params arrayK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-06Refactoring of Processes.phpK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-05Remove tracking's selection_* global variablesM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-05Add method to validate logtype request paramM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-05Fix error after #17819 mergeMaurício Meneghini Fauth
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-05Refactor Display\Results::getOffsets() methodMaurício Meneghini Fauth
Improves type inference. Signed-off-by: Maurício Meneghini Fauth <mauricio@fauth.dev>
2022-11-05fix #17779 - PHP 8 numeric operation (#17827)aliber4079
Fixes #17779 php8 throws exception in spite of @ symbol so work around it Signed-off-by: Alex Liberman <alex@zoosmart.us>
2022-11-05Introduce ServerRequest::hasBodyParam() (#17870)Kamil Tekiela
* Drop Sql::setUiProp() * Remove ternary operator * Improve array guard * Remove redundant isset * Implement hasBodyParam() * Add has() and hasQueryParam()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-05Minor stylistic changes (#17865)Kamil Tekiela
* Stylistic changes to make refactoring easier * Parameter $where was unnecessarily nullable * Refactor Routines::getDetails() * Refactor Events::getDetails() * Refactor Triggers::getDetails() * Split up QueryGenerator::getInformationSchemaColumnsFullRequest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-05Merge pull request #17862 from kamil-tekiela/Refactor-displayHtmlForColumnChangeMaurício Meneghini Fauth
Refactor ChangeController and use ServerRequest
2022-11-05Merge pull request #17859 from kamil-tekiela/more-globalsMaurício Meneghini Fauth
Fix Replica bugs Fixes #17849 Closes #17856
2022-11-03Fix import/export escapingKamil Tekiela
Signed-off-by: Kamil Tekiela <tekiela246@gmail.com>
2022-11-03Merge #17864 - Fix #17793 - insert record - fix null not selected if ↵William Desportes
nullable UUID & insert error Pull-request: #17860 Fixes: #17793 Signed-off-by: William Desportes <williamdes@wdes.fr>
2022-11-03Merge branch 'QA_5_2'William Desportes
Signed-off-by: William Desportes <williamdes@wdes.fr>
2022-11-03[ISSUE-17793] Remove unreachable conditionMo Sureerat
Signed-off-by: Mo Sureerat <sureemo@gmail.com>
2022-11-03[ISSUE-17793] Add more test for coverageMo Sureerat
Signed-off-by: Mo Sureerat <sureemo@gmail.com>
2022-11-03[ISSUE-17793] Fix static analysis warningMo Sureerat
Signed-off-by: Mo Sureerat <sureemo@gmail.com>
2022-11-03[ISSUE-17793] Fix static analysis warningMo Sureerat
Signed-off-by: Mo Sureerat <sureemo@gmail.com>
2022-11-03[ISSUE-17793] UUID - Fix insert errorMo Sureerat
Signed-off-by: Mo Sureerat <sureemo@gmail.com>
2022-11-03[ISSUE-17793] Revert previous change + Fix default selection of uuid in ↵Mo Sureerat
alter table Signed-off-by: Mo Sureerat <sureemo@gmail.com>
2022-11-03[ISSUE-17793] Insert record - fix null not selected if nullable UUID + ↵Mo Sureerat
insert error Signed-off-by: Mo Sureerat <sureemo@gmail.com>